Dive into functional drawing! Join information designer and artist Catherine Madden for a 60-minute class demystifying how drawing can help you communicate ideas clearer, faster, and stronger. As she draws everyday data into friendly stories and charts, you'll learn how a few simple moves can help you organize your ideas, extend your brainstorming, and communicate complex concepts simply (and effectively) to audiences of every size.

This class is ideal for:

  • a designer, writer, or artist eager to share stories in a visual way
  • a creative team looking to communicate and collaborate faster
  • an entrepreneur honing a persuasive pitch

Use this class to learn functional drawing techniques and unlock the power of visual thinking!

ASSIGNMENT
Your assignment is to visually communicate a journey.
Tip 1:Draw a journey you take often. This might be your daily commute to work, trip to the gym, or walk to your favorite coffee shop. Choosing something you visit a few times a week will ensure all the "data" is quickly available in your own head.
Tip 2:Don't get too caught up in the mind map. Map for just 5 minutes, then get drawing! You can always add to your map later. If you're feeling stuck, consider modes of transportation, factors that change your approach/route, and notable landmarks.
Tip 3:Challenge yourself to create 3-5 drawings. Just like in the class lessons, it took me a few tries before I found my favorite "drawn story." And experiment! You can use my bar charts as inspiration, but feel free to try Venn diagrams, pie charts, line graphs, or something totally new.
Most importantly, have fun, share your progress early and often, and exchange feedback with each other. This is an awesome opportunity for us to discover new ways to unlock the power of drawing.
